Identification of scFv antibody fragments that specifically recognise the heroin metabolite 6-monoacetylmorphine but not morphine.

Abstract

Use of phage display of recombinant antibodies and large repertoire naïve antibody libraries for identifying antibodies of high specificity has been extensively reported. Nevertheless, there have been few reported antibodies to haptens that have originated from naïve antibody libraries with potential use in diagnostics. We have used chain shuffling of lead single-chain fragment variable (scFv) antibodies, isolated from a naïve antibody library, to screen for antibodies that specifically recognise the major metabolite of heroin, 6-monoacetylmorphine (6MAM). The antibodies were identified by screening high-density colonies of Escherichia coli expressing soluble scFv antibody fragments without prior expression on bacteriophage (phage display). The antibodies recognise 6MAM with affinities of 1-3x10(-7) M with no crossreactivity to morphine. These antibodies can potentially be used for developing a rapid immunoassay in drug-testing programs. To our knowledge, this is the first report of an antibody that distinguishes 6MAM from its de-acetylated form, morphine.
